This book is full of stories of Maya Angelou's life
Her stories range from sad to hopeful to funny to heartbreaking, and are all told in a distinctive voice. Stories are told with specific mix of youthful innocence and drama along with mature knowledge.
I did, quite honestly, find the stories a little disconnected and slow to go through, but this book was really powerful, and the end was especially hopeful and beautiful.
PG-13+ For rape and other triggering topics
